The Hon. Claire L. Borengasser (Ret.) served as a judge for the Fort Smith Division of the Sebastian County District Court in Arkansas. She retired on June 1, 2022.
Borengasser earned a bachelor’s degree from the University of Arkansas in 1975. She then completed a J.D. at the University of Arkansas School of Law in 1987.
After graduating from law school, Borengasser began her legal career as a deputy prosecuting attorney for the Sebastian County Prosecuting Attorney’s Office. She worked in that capacity until 1996. Borengasser also spent time as an attorney in the Law Offices of Charles Karr in Fort Smith. During her tenure there, she specialized in medical malpractice, product liability, wrongful death, negligence, employment, family, criminal defense, and oil and gas matters.
Her memberships have included the Sebastian County Bar Association. She is admitted to practice in Arkansas (1988), the United States District Court for the Western District of Arkansas (1996), and the United States Court of Appeals for the Eighth Circuit (1997).
Borengasser was born in Fort Smith, Arkansas.
